Overview
Kilimanjaro International Airport (JRO) is strategically located between the cities of Arusha and Moshi in northern Tanzania. Billing itself as the "Gateway to Africa's Wildlife Heritage," JRO is the primary entry point for adventurers embarking on safaris in the world-renowned Serengeti National Park, exploring the Ngorongoro Conservation Area, visiting Tarangire and Lake Manyara National Parks, or undertaking the challenging climb to the summit of Mount Kilimanjaro, Africa's highest peak.
Though not a cruise port, JRO is a bustling international airport that connects travelers from across the globe to some of the most spectacular natural wonders on Earth. Its compact size makes for relatively easy navigation, and it serves as the starting point for an unforgettable journey into Tanzania's rich biodiversity, stunning landscapes, and vibrant cultures.
The ultimate East African experience for many, a safari in Serengeti National Park (a UNESCO World Heritage site) offers unparalleled wildlife viewing. Witness the Great Migration (seasonal), spot the "Big Five" (lion, leopard, elephant, rhino, buffalo), and immerse yourself in vast savannah landscapes teeming with animals.
Tip: This is typically a multi-day safari and requires significant travel by vehicle from Arusha or Moshi. Book through a reputable safari operator.
Visit the Ngorongoro Conservation Area, another UNESCO World Heritage site and home to the spectacular Ngorongoro Crater. This vast, unbroken caldera is a natural enclosure for an incredible concentration of wildlife, offering some of the best game viewing in Africa.
Tip: Often combined with a Serengeti safari. Guides are essential here, and specific rules apply to protect the unique ecosystem.
For the adventurous, undertake a multi-day trek to the summit of Mount Kilimanjaro, the highest free-standing mountain in the world and Africa's highest peak. Various routes cater to different fitness levels, offering stunning views and a profound personal challenge.
Tip: This requires significant physical preparation and is a multi-day endeavor (5-9 days). Book with an experienced and reputable trekking company. Allow for pre- and post-climb rest days.
Explore Arusha National Park, a smaller but incredibly diverse park located close to Arusha city. It boasts a variety of landscapes, including the slopes of Mount Meru, the Momella Lakes (with flamingos), and offers opportunities for walking safaris, canoeing, and wildlife viewing (giraffes, zebras, buffalo, various primates).
Tip: This can be a great single-day safari option for those with less time, or a relaxed introduction to Tanzanian wildlife.
Gain insight into the vibrant culture of the Maasai people by visiting a traditional village near the national parks. Learn about their customs, traditions, dances, and daily life, often involving a visit to their bomas (homesteads).
Tip: Choose an ethical tour operator that ensures the community benefits directly from your visit. Be respectful and ask permission before taking photos of people.
Spend time in Moshi, the bustling town at the foot of Mount Kilimanjaro. Explore its local markets, soak in the views of the mountain, and consider a tour to a nearby coffee plantation to learn about coffee production from bean to cup, often followed by a tasting.
Tip: Moshi is a common base for Kilimanjaro climbers and offers a more laid-back atmosphere than Arusha.
